Q. The police charged him . . . . . . . . stealing the jewels.
  • (A) to
  • (B) of
  • (C) with
  • (D) in
βœ… Correct Answer: (C) with

Explanation: 'Charge with' means 'to accuse someone of something, especially to officially accuse someone of a crime'. Hence it makes the sentence meaningful.
